Antiself-dual Yang-Mills, modified Faddeevs-Jackiw formalism and hidden BRS invariance
From MaRDI portal
Publication:2828593
Abstract: We analyze the constraints for a system of anti self-dual Yang-Mills (ASDYM) equations by means of the modified Faddeev-Jackiw method in K and J gauges `{a} la Yang. We also establish the Hamiltonian flow for ASDYM system through the hidden BRS invariance in both the gauges. Finally, we remark on the bi-Hamiltonian nature of ASDYM and the compatibility of the symplectic structures therein.
